AUSTnet Development-开源
AUSTnet Development是一个专注于开源软件开发的团队,其主要任务是为AUSTnet IRC(Internet Relay Chat)网络提供技术支持和软件解决方案。IRC是一种实时在线聊天系统,允许用户通过频道进行交流,而AUSTnet则是这一网络中的一个节点,提供全球范围内的服务。 开源软件是指源代码可以自由查看、修改和分发的软件。这种模式鼓励社区协作和创新,开发者们可以基于已有的代码库进行改进,创建出更适应用户需求的功能。AUSTnet Development团队选择开源路径,意味着他们致力于透明度、共享和合作,这通常会导致更稳定、更可靠的软件产品。 在开源世界中,团队的工作可能包括编写和维护服务器软件,如IRC服务器软件(例如ircd-hybrid, UnrealIRCd或 InspIRCd),客户端应用程序,或者各种插件和工具,以增强IRC网络的功能和用户体验。这些软件可能涉及身份验证、安全、性能优化、多语言支持等多个方面。 文件名为"austhex8"可能是AUSTnet Development团队开发的一个特定项目或版本的名称,或者是某个工具或模块的代号。由于没有具体文件内容,我们无法详细解读这个名称所代表的具体含义。然而,通常情况下,这样的命名可能代表了一次软件更新或特定功能的实现,比如“hex”可能暗示与十六进制数据处理相关,或者仅仅是团队内部的一种命名约定。 开源软件开发团队的工作流程通常包括以下步骤: 1. **需求分析**:确定IRC网络的需求,例如新的功能、性能改进或安全修复。 2. **设计**:制定软件架构和模块划分,确保可扩展性和维护性。 3. **编码**:开发者编写代码,遵循团队的编码规范,保证代码质量。 4. **测试**:进行单元测试、集成测试和系统测试,确保软件的稳定性和可靠性。 5. **版本控制**:利用Git等版本控制系统管理代码,记录每一次变更。 6. **代码审查**:团队成员相互审查代码,找出潜在问题并提出改进建议。 7. **文档**:编写用户手册和技术文档,帮助用户理解和使用软件。 8. **发布**:发布软件新版本,同时提供持续的更新和支持。 9. **社区参与**:鼓励用户和开发者参与,接受反馈,不断优化软件。 AUSTnet Development团队的开源工作不仅有助于AUSTnet IRC网络的发展,也为整个IRC社区提供了宝贵的资源。他们的贡献促进了技术的共享和进步,降低了软件开发的成本,同时也为其他类似项目提供了学习和借鉴的实例。
- 1
- 2
- 3
- 4
- 5
- 6
- 粉丝: 27
- 资源: 4684
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助